Description

 

JOB SUMMARY:

 

Install, functional test and troubleshoot avionics/electrical systems.

 

JOB RESPONSIBILITIES:

 

  • Functional test and repair electrical, electronic and communication systems during assembly and flight test of production aircraft.

  • Work from airplane orders, schematic drawings, engineering specifications, inspection records, standard shop practices, oral and written instructions to functional test a variety of standard and optional electrical and electronic systems under minimum supervision.

  • General supervision needed in order the complete tasks plus additional on the job training required.

  • Assists with finding solutions in order to solve problems.

  • Listens to concerns and responds appropriately based on feedback given through the learning curve.

  • Identify need for improvements and provides recommendations for safety improvements.
